The Hidden Science: Biology Meets Modern Living

freshman students spend countless hours navigating dorm fatigue, group project dynamics, and constant social shifts—all within a complex biological framework. One key hidden secret? Circadian rhythms aren’t just something checked off in a physiology class—they dictate your academic performance, sleep quality, and stress resilience. Late-night campus Wi-Fi rushes or early morning lectures may seem trivial, but misaligned circadian patterns can reduce focus by over 30%.

Understanding your body’s internal clock—how caffeine, light, and social schedules affect it—unlocks smarter study habits and better sleep hygiene. This isn’t just sleep science; it’s campus survival science.

Light exposure—especially artificial blue light at night—shapes your brain chemistry, yet most students barely think twice about their campus lighting conditions. Science reveals that dim, warm lighting triggers melatonin release, promoting rest, while bright LED lights suppress it. Understanding this hidden physics helps undergrads design study zones that optimize alertness and recovery.

Even campus architecture—built spaces that channel sound, airflow, or natural light—exerts subtle but measurable effects on concentration and mood. The science of space is science, even when no professor mentions it.
